In addition to seeking the expertise of designers to come up with an aesthetically pleasing and functional home, you can look to the following design trends to guide you:

1. Wabi-Sabi

This popular Japanese adage celebrates the beauty of imperfection. In a world beset by the pursuit of unrealistic standards, some homeowners find comfort and beauty for natural and timeworn pieces. As people move toward a greater appreciation for asymmetry and embrace natural materials, designers expect “wabi-sabi” to become a massive trend for 2018.

2. Off-Black

Black used to be too bold and unforgiving for interiors, but designers have come up with a way to bring it back into homes. Much like when “off-white” took off as an alternative to stark, blinding whites, the off-black uses the chalky, softer versions of the shade. This is a perfect backdrop for almost any color and can enhance any interior style.

3. House Jungle

Plants are creeping back into the interior design mania, mostly because of millennials who want to fill every corner of their homes with botanical items. This “jungle fever” inspired design trend is set to become a national obsession this year. The mini potted succulents and large planters offer a pop of color and a breath of fresh air into any room.

4. Peach

Blush pink was in abundance throughout 2017, but for this year, the revival of peach is on the horizon. Fuse the delicate tone with a bold statement to bring a twist to this classic favorite.

The emerging styles of this year focus on combining old and new ideas for unique and timeless interior spaces. Be inspired by these trends and bring an exciting change into your living space.
